verb

Definition of DULL

1
to reduce or weaken in strength or feeling <the aspirin dulled his headache and he was soon feeling better>
Antonyms sharpen, whet
2
to make white or lighter by removing color <the painting's once-vivid colors have been dulled by time>
Related Words brighten, lighten; dim, mat (also matte or matt); etiolate; whitewash; frost, silver
Antonyms darken, deepen, embrown
